Education
- Ph.D. Electrical and Computer Engineering
The University of Illinois at Chicago, 2002
Dissertation: Estimating electro-mechanical properties of the heart
Advisor: Prof. Arye Nehorai
- M.Sc. Electrical Engineering and Computer Science
The University of Illinois at Chicago, 1997
- B.Sc. Electrical Engineering
University of Belgrade, Yugoslavia, 1995
